Mission Statement

Pikes Peak Chapter of Trout Unlimited - ​PPCTU strives to conserve, protect, and restore cold-water fisheries resources ​and their watersheds in the Pikes Peak Region and throughout the state of Colorado.

Description

PPCTU defines our role as a leading conservation organization under 3 objectives:
Objective 1

Protect Native Trout: Primary focus for 2022 is on native cutthroats in our Pike Peak Region by focusing on ongoing education, and the initial /reintroduction and maintain Cutthroat trout in the Pikes Peak Region.

Objective 2

Improve AND PROTECT HABITAT (conservation versus recreation): Improve and conserve the cold water habitats and enhance fishing opportunities in the Pikes Peak Region. (notes also include wording to seek opportunities t increase and improve angler access)
